Project Chief - Automotive Air Induction and Exhaust Systems/components

Technical program manager for one or more vehicle lines, responsible for ensuring that the Air Induction and Exhaust systems meet all functional and performance requirements while meeting cost, weight, investment, timing, and quality objectives. Components include body mounted heat shields, hot and cold end exhaust including brackets, air box with filter, dirty and clean side ducts and charge air cooler ducts for turbo applications. Candidate will lead air induction and exhaust systems responsibilities at any point from the initial concept phase through end of life, providing strong support of concept studies, initial packaging, function targets, cost and weight analysis, prototype procurement, supplier management, sourcing, tooling kickoff, validation, launch, program maintenance, change management, value optimization, and quality improvement initiatives.
